General Info

Year: 2004
Duration: c. 5:00
Difficulty: IV (see Ratings for explanation)
Publisher: Gorilla Salad Productions / Distributed by Hal Leonard
Cost: Score and Parts - $115.00   |   Score Only - $25.00

Program Notes

This simple, chorale-like work captures the reflective calm of dusk, paradoxically illuminated by the fiery hues of sunset. I'm always struck by the dual nature of this experience, as if witnessing an event of epic proportions silently occurring in slow motion. Dusk is intended as a short, passionate evocation of this moment of dramatic stillness.

Dusk was commissioned by the Langley High School Wind Symphony, Andrew Gekoskie, conductor, and was premiered in April 2004 at the MENC National Convention by the commissioning ensemble.

Program Note by Steven Bryant
